What Are The Differences Between Silicone And Its Curing Agent

What are the differences between silicone and its curing agent

 

There are significant differences between silicone curing agent and silicone in many aspects. The following is a detailed explanation of the differences between the two:

1. Definition and properties

Silicone curing agent: Silicone curing agent is a cross-linking agent used to cure silicone materials. It is a polycondensation-type two-component silicone rubber (RTV-2) cross-linking agent. Through chemical reaction, the silicone material forms a three-dimensional network structure to achieve curing. There are various types of silicone curing agents, including acidic curing agents, peroxide curing agents, alkylation curing agents, platinum-based curing agents, etc. Each curing agent has its own unique characteristics and application fields.
2. Functions and uses

Silicone curing agent: The main function is to cause the silicone material to undergo a curing reaction, thereby giving the silicone products the required physical and chemical properties. The selection and use of silicone curing agent has a vital impact on the performance and quality of silicone products.

Silicone curing agent: has various ingredients, including organic silicon compounds, peroxides, platinum catalysts, etc. Silicone curing agent has the characteristics of high reactivity, fast curing speed, and few reaction by-products. Different types of silicone curing agents differ in terms of curing speed, reaction conditions, and properties of cured products.
4. Interrelationship
There is a close relationship between silicone curing agents and silicone. Silicone curing agent is one of the key factors in the curing reaction of silicone materials. Without the participation of curing agent, silicone cannot form products with required properties. Therefore, in the production process of silicone products, selecting the appropriate silicone curing agent and strictly controlling its use conditions are crucial to ensuring the quality of the product.
